Output 85e982321301d671bfd0c41dba885550738c89a89f2abc41a2b5d82417b5b99a:1

value
2170728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f8962894e52c273569f4af1b0bf1e5772096c3 OP_EQUAL
address
3L6wYCTmg3GJaz33izgkBC5je7eDcgA8yW
transaction
85e982321301d671bfd0c41dba885550738c89a89f2abc41a2b5d82417b5b99a
spent
true